Problem

The D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system experiences slow response speeds due to offline switching of operating states, which affects its ability to adapt to varying energy conditions efficiently.

Innovation Solution

An online switching method and device that monitors photovoltaic energy levels to switch operating states dynamically, allowing the system to transition from grid-connected battery priority to nighttime battery discharge without shutting down, using direct current converters and inverters to manage power distribution.

AI summary

A D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system, an operating state switching method and device of the D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system are provided according to the present disclosure. The method includes: obtaining photovoltaic energy of the D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system and determining whether the photovoltaic energy is sufficient, in a case that the D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system operates in a grid-connected battery priority state; and if it is determined that the photovoltaic energy is insufficient, performing an online switchover operation, where the online switchover operation is used to switch the operating state of the DC-coupled photovoltaic power generation system from the grid-connected battery priority state to a nighttime battery discharge state.
